Patents by Inventor Farid Harhad

Farid Harhad has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11422874
    Abstract: Web application code includes a unified rendering application programming interface (API) library and unified rendering API calls. The unified rendering API calls comply with call definitions and are to library functions. The library functions are in both a server rendering library and a client rendering library. The call definitions are the same for using the server rendering library and the client rendering library. From a client computing device and a server computing device, a rendering system is identified for rendering a visualization to obtain an identified system. The rendering library matching the rendering system is linked to the web application code, where the rendering library is at least of the client rendering library or the server rendering library.
    Type: Grant
    Filed: September 12, 2018
    Date of Patent: August 23, 2022
    Assignee: Schlumberger Technology Corporation
    Inventors: Alain Cudennec, Farid Harhad, Arnaud Houegbelo, Yuri Vanzine
  • Publication number: 20200401468
    Abstract: Web application code includes a unified rendering application programming interface (API) library and unified rendering API calls. The unified rendering API calls comply with call definitions and are to library functions. The library functions are in both a server rendering library and a client rendering library. The call definitions are the same for using the server rendering library and the client rendering library. From a client computing device and a server computing device, a rendering system is identified for rendering a visualization to obtain an identified system. The rendering library matching the rendering system is linked to the web application code, where the rendering library is at least of the client rendering library or the server rendering library.
    Type: Application
    Filed: September 12, 2018
    Publication date: December 24, 2020
    Applicant: Schlumberger Technology Corporation
    Inventors: Alain CUDENNEC, Farid HARHAD, Arnaud HOUEGBELO, Yuri VANZINE
  • Patent number: 8462153
    Abstract: The present invention relates to a method of displaying a dynamic 2D annotation associated with an object displayed in a 3D scene. The method includes providing a computer system that includes a display device; establishing a view location and direction; orienting the dynamic 2D annotation substantially perpendicular to the view direction; orienting the dynamic 2D annotation substantially horizontal relative to the 3D scene; positioning the dynamic 2D annotation relative to an attachment point on or near the object; extending an attachment handle between the dynamic 2D annotation and the attachment point; and displaying the dynamic 2D annotation and the attachment handle in the 3D scene on the display device.
    Type: Grant
    Filed: April 24, 2009
    Date of Patent: June 11, 2013
    Assignee: Schlumberger Technology Corporation
    Inventors: Dmitriy Repin, Vivek Singh, Farid Harhad
  • Patent number: 8199166
    Abstract: A method for visualizing oilfield data of an oilfield operation involves obtaining real-time data generated from a borehole, generating and updating a current position object, and displaying and annotating a representation of a first geology, geophysics, drilling, and production object in a display based on the oilfield data using a two dimensional (2D) callout having an attachment handle for adjusting the 2D callout according the updated location in an animation sequence in real-time responsive to updating the current position.
    Type: Grant
    Filed: February 13, 2009
    Date of Patent: June 12, 2012
    Assignee: Schlumberger Technology Corporation
    Inventors: Dmitriy Repin, Vivek Singh, Christos Nikolakis-Mouchas, Farid Harhad, Syed Hammad Zafar
  • Publication number: 20100271391
    Abstract: The present invention relates to a method of displaying a dynamic 2D annotation associated with an object displayed in a 3D scene. The method includes providing a computer system that includes a display device; establishing a view location and direction; orienting the dynamic 2D annotation substantially perpendicular to the view direction; orienting the dynamic 2D annotation substantially horizontal relative to the 3D scene; positioning the dynamic 2D annotation relative to an attachment point on or near the object; extending an attachment handle between the dynamic 2D annotation and the attachment point; and displaying the dynamic 2D annotation and the attachment handle in the 3D scene on the display device.
    Type: Application
    Filed: April 24, 2009
    Publication date: October 28, 2010
    Applicant: Schlumberger Technology Corporation
    Inventors: Dmitriy Repin, Vivek Singh, Farid Harhad
  • Publication number: 20090229819
    Abstract: A method for visualizing oilfield data of an oilfield operation involves obtaining real-time data generated from a borehole, generating and updating a current position object, and displaying and annotating a representation of a first geology, geophysics, drilling, and production object in a display based on the oilfield data using a two dimensional (2D) callout having an attachment handle for adjusting the 2D callout according the updated location in an animation sequence in real-time responsive to updating the current position.
    Type: Application
    Filed: February 13, 2009
    Publication date: September 17, 2009
    Applicant: Schlumberger Technlogy Corporation
    Inventors: Dmitriy Repin, Vivek Singh, Christos Nikolakis-Mouchas, Farid Harhad, Syed Hammad Zafar